Introduction
The Global Biomedical Foundation (GBF) specializes in the collection, storage and distribution of rare and highly characterized biological samples such as disease state plasma to meet clinical research management requirements. GBF takes pride in contributing to research by providing access to high quality and well-annotated biospecimen materials with full regulatory compliance. GBF works with a network of laboratories, clinics and medical doctors, located in Latin America which identify and collect clinically significant blood products. GBF specializes primarily in infectious diseases. They serve the market for biological materials for pharmacogenomics, from non-infectious diseases, genetic disorders to immune-allergies.
Business Challenges
According to Maykel Hernandez, COO for GBF, “The first objective was to find a system that would drive compliance with CDC standards so that they could facilitate accreditation and the associated audit requirements. The second was to replace all the manual reports with online reports. Our turn-around time was too long and we were doing a lot of typing into spreadsheets for reporting.”
CloudLIMS Solution
GBF started looking for a sample management solution that was intuitive, user friendly and configurable. The aim was to use a best-in-class solution and to establish laboratory-wide consistency. GBF personnel learned about CloudLIMS’s SaaS model while attending the largest biobanking congress, ISBER. After taking an online demo, they determined that the product was in line with their laboratory needs and the overall business plan. Most importantly, it was a system that they did not have to set up, deploy or manage themselves, especially when resources were being consumed managing the business needs.
